new2reefin Posted September 9, 2017 Share Posted September 9, 2017 I've been trying to find some recent reviews and comparisons of these three dry rock brands but everything I find is from a couple years ago. I want to purchase rock for my IM Lagoon 25 and I've narrowed it down to these 3 options. Is one better than any other, and if so why? Any experience you've had with either three is appreciated. Tamberav Posted September 10, 2017 Share Posted September 10, 2017 Big fan of reef-cleaners, very porous, clean (just rinse and add to tank), and you can request what you want or share your tank size and he will try and make it happen. Quote Link to comment

Reef cleaners rock is more porous than brs reef saver and marco rocks Quote Link to comment
Goneaway562 Posted September 10, 2017 Share Posted September 10, 2017 I have only used reef cleaners and I can vouch that it is great and easy to add. I told John what tank I had and what I planned on doing for my aquascape and he picked out great rocks. Quote Link to comment

R_Pierce Posted October 24, 2017 Share Posted October 24, 2017 I have bought reef cleaners in the past, and purchased marco's this time. Honestly there wasnt a huge difference between the two. Both are quality dry rock, with amazing porosity and looks. Quote Link to comment
